Make the Skeleton Dance
by Barry Maher

Barry Maher

In 1912, the printer was all set to run three million copies of Teddy Roosevelt's nomination speech, complete with photographs of Roosevelt and his VP candidate, the immortal Hiram Johnson. Then the chairman of the campaign committee discovered that no one had obtained permission from the photographer who had taken the pictures. Legal penalties for the copyright violation could be as much as $3 million.

Two Heads Are Better Than One
by Peggy Van Arnam

Syracuse University

In a complex situation or in creating something very important, discussing things with others, getting their ideas and weighing their suggestions are helpful and usually produce a better end result. In re-designing the SME-International CME and CSE certification programs, Syracuse University developers found the participation of members of SMEI’s Buffalo affiliate, the Accreditation Committee and the Board’s Executive Committee immensely helpful in creating accurate, fair and relevant certification tests and study materials. As SME-International and the University now turn to re-designing the third program (SCPS), we invite a corporate partner or two to help us in the development of this project.
